Instructions:
Step 1
Ensure the whipped cream is thoroughly chilled before starting. You can refrigerate it for a couple of hours prior to preparation. Also, after washing, remove the stems from the strawberries and dice them into small pieces.
Step 2
In a large mixing bowl, beat the chilled whipped cream until stiff peaks form. The duration will depend on the speed of your mixer.
Step 3
Gently fold in the condensed milk using a spatula once the whipped cream reaches room temperature.
Step 3
Be careful not to overmix to maintain the desired texture.
Step 4
Add the diced strawberries to the mixture, ensuring they are evenly distributed for a well-rounded flavor.
Step 5
Transfer the ice cream mixture to a freezer-safe container with a snug-fitting lid. Use a spatula to smooth the top evenly.
